What Are Mortgage Loan Pre-Approvals?
A home loan pre-approval serves as a stamp of approval from lenders confirming your financial readiness to buy a home. Before you get pre-approved, the lender will evaluate your debt-to-income ratio and creditworthiness. Upon approval, you will receive a statement that serves as their conditional commitment to lending you money to buy your home while also showing how much they are willing to give you.
Pre-approval Vs Prequalification - What's The Difference?
A prequalification gives you a rough idea of how much you can borrow based on what you tell the lender about your finances. Pre-approval, on the other hand, means the lender has checked and confirmed your financial information, giving you a conditional thumbs-up for a specific loan amount.
When Should You Get Pre-Approved?
You can get approved for a mortgage in as little as one business day if your paperwork is in order, while other lenders may take longer. Pre-approvals are usually valid for 90 days. However, some lenders may keep it valid for 30 or 60 days.
We recommend you start before looking for a home to ensure you can make an offer on the home you like on time.
Do Pre-approvals Affect Your Credit Score?
Before you get preapproved for a mortgage, lenders carry out a hard pull of your credit to check your score, temporarily lowering it by a few points. However, you will have a 45-day window in which multiple credit score inquiries will be considered on your credit report. Are you worried about denial? Pre-Approval Costs in 78956 Zip Code, Texas
You may be wondering if you need to pay money to get pre-approved for a mortgage loan in 78956 Zip Code, Texas. That depends on the lender you choose to work with. Some do it for free, while others demand a non-refundable application fee you must pay upfront, whether you get approved or not.

Documents Required for Pre-Approval
Getting pre-approved for a mortgage loan in the 78956 Zip Code, Texas, requires gathering essential documents to help our mortgage brokers at Summit Lending assess your financial situation accurately. This process streamlines your path to homeownership. Below is a list of key documents you'll need. Note that while requirements are generally standard, Texas-specific rules may include additional verification for property taxes or insurance, so consult with one of our loan officers for personalized guidance.
- Proof of Income: Recent pay stubs (typically the last 30 days) and W-2 forms from the past two years. If self-employed, provide tax returns for the last two years. This helps verify your stable income for purchase loans or refinance loans in Texas.
- Employment Verification: A letter from your employer confirming your job title, salary, and length of employment. For contract workers, include contracts or additional income proofs. Our team can guide you through this as part of the pre-approval process.
- Asset Statements: Bank statements for the last two to three months showing checking, savings, and investment accounts. This demonstrates your down payment funds and reserves. Use our loan calculator to estimate how these assets impact your mortgage options.
- Debt Information: Statements for all debts, including credit cards, auto loans, student loans, and other obligations for the past 12 months. This is crucial for calculating your debt-to-income ratio, especially for commercial loans or reverse loans in Texas.
- Identification: A valid driver's license or government-issued ID, plus your Social Security number. In Texas, you may also need to provide proof of residency. Once ready, upload these securely via our application portal to start your first-time home buyer journey or other loan types.

Factors Affecting Pre-Approval in Texas 78956 Area
When seeking pre-approval for a mortgage loan in the 78956 zip code area of Texas, several key factors play a crucial role in determining your eligibility and the terms you might receive. Understanding these elements can help you prepare effectively and improve your chances of securing favorable financing from trusted providers like Summit Lending.
Credit Score and History: Your credit score is one of the most significant determinants in the pre-approval process. Lenders typically look for a score of at least 620 for conventional loans, though higher scores can unlock better interest rates and loan options. A strong credit history, free of late payments, bankruptcies, or excessive debt, demonstrates reliability. If your score needs improvement, consider reviewing your credit report and addressing any issues before applying. For personalized guidance on how your credit impacts mortgage loans in 78956, reach out to our experienced loan officers.
Debt-to-Income Ratio (DTI): This ratio measures your monthly debt payments against your gross monthly income, ideally keeping it under 43% for most lenders. A lower DTI signals to lenders that you can comfortably manage additional mortgage payments. Factors like existing loans, credit card balances, and other obligations contribute to this calculation. To optimize your DTI, pay down debts or increase your income where possible. Summit Lending's team can help assess your DTI during the pre-approval process in nearby areas like Schulenburg, ensuring you're positioned for success in 78956.
Employment Stability: Consistent employment history, typically over the last two years, reassures lenders of your ability to repay the loan. Frequent job changes or gaps in employment can raise concerns, so documentation like pay stubs and W-2 forms is essential. Self-employed individuals may need additional proof, such as tax returns. Stable income from verifiable sources strengthens your application. Our loan officers with decades of experience can guide you through verifying employment details for a smooth pre-approval.
Local Market Conditions in 78956: The real estate landscape in the 78956 area, part of Fayette County, Texas, influences pre-approval outcomes through property values and prevailing interest rates. Median home prices in this rural yet growing region hover around affordable levels, making it attractive for purchase loans. However, local factors like agricultural influences and proximity to larger cities can affect appraisals and loan-to-value ratios. Interest rates in Texas are competitive, often aligning with national averages but varying based on economic conditions. Common Challenges and How to Overcome Them
Getting pre-approved for a mortgage loan in the 78956 zip code, Texas, can be a smooth process with the right preparation, but several common challenges may arise. At Summit Lending, our experienced loan officers are here to guide you through these hurdles. Below, we outline key challenges and practical strategies to overcome them.
Low Credit Score
A low credit score is one of the most frequent obstacles to mortgage pre-approval. Lenders typically look for a FICO score of at least 620 for conventional loans, but scores below that can limit options or increase interest rates. To improve your score:
- Check your credit report for errors and dispute inaccuracies via the major bureaus.
- Pay down outstanding balances to lower your credit utilization ratio below 30%.
- Avoid new credit applications, as they can temporarily drop your score.
Building credit takes time, but even small improvements can make a difference. Visit our About page to learn more about how our team can assist with credit-building advice tailored to Texas borrowers.
High Debt Levels
High debt-to-income (DTI) ratios, where your monthly debts exceed 43-50% of your income, can jeopardize pre-approval. In the 78956 area, where living costs may vary, managing DTI is crucial. Strategies to reduce it include:
- Pay off high-interest debts like credit cards first to free up monthly payments.
- Consolidate loans or refinance existing debts to lower payments.
- Increase your income through side gigs or raises, if possible.
Our Loan Officers specialize in analyzing your financial situation to optimize DTI for pre-approval. For personalized calculations, use our Loan Calculator.
Texas-Specific Issues: Property Taxes and Rural Lending Guidelines in 78956
In Texas, particularly in rural areas like the 78956 zip code near Schulenburg in Fayette County, high property taxes and stricter rural lending guidelines pose unique challenges. Texas has no state income tax, but property taxes average around 1.8% of home value, which can inflate escrow requirements and affect affordability.
